Not aligned on objectives and key results<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p id=\"6f1f\">Another common productivity challenge at tech companies is misalignment on objectives or key results (OKRs).<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p id=\"7ccb\">Because OKRs are usually set higher than what a team can achieve, 70% satisfaction is often deemed a success. Although this is common practice, it can cause some confusion when goals that are set are never met. This can demotivate a team which in turn leads to a lack of productivity.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p id=\"3767\">While OKRs are well respected and utilized by most tech companies, you might find that a different method works better for your team.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p id=\"10ba\">The solution can also be different levels and types of OKRs, those which are expected to be met (and can provide a sense of accomplishment), and those that are a bit loftier.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<blockquote class=\"wp-block-quote\">\n<p>\u201cOur top productivity problem is reaching our sales goals consistently. We have some months where we crush our sales goals and others where we barely meet half of our desired numbers. We may need to reset our sales goals to something more reasonable that we can attain at all times. In the end, I think that the problem with our sales team productivity is establishing a standard operating procedure (SOP) that we can follow at all times to achieve consistent goals.\u201d<br>\u2014 Malte Scholz, CEO and Co-founder of&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/airfocus.com\/\">Airfocus<\/a><\/p>\n<\/blockquote>\n\n\n\n<p id=\"bc8c\">If your team is only ever meeting half the goals, then it\u2019s time to uncover the cause for the lapse of productivity and decide whether or not the goals themselves are part of the issue.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<div style=\"height:100px\" aria-hidden=\"true\" class=\"wp-block-spacer\"><\/div>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\" id=\"762e\">Problem 3. Knowledge workers, teams, and departments all use different apps <\/h3>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-large\"><img decoding=\"async\" loading=\"lazy\" width=\"1024\" height=\"552\" src=\"https:\/\/images.golinks.io\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/12\/13102220\/tools2-2-1024x552.png\" alt=\"Productivity problem: teams using different apps\" class=\"wp-image-3636\" srcset=\"https:\/\/images.golinks.io\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/12\/13102220\/tools2-2-1024x552.png 1024w, https:\/\/images.golinks.io\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/12\/13102220\/tools2-2-300x162.png 300w, https:\/\/images.golinks.io\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/12\/13102220\/tools2-2-768x414.png 768w, https:\/\/images.golinks.io\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/12\/13102220\/tools2-2-40x22.png 40w, https:\/\/images.golinks.io\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/12\/13102220\/tools2-2-670x361.png 670w, https:\/\/images.golinks.io\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/12\/13102220\/tools2-2.png 1340w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 1024px) 100vw, 1024px\" \/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p id=\"324e\">The&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/www.youtube.com\/watch?v=LVi-OIGidcw\">consumerization of B2B tech<\/a>&nbsp;is great for companies that offer free and affordable tools that employees can get started with all on their own. But it\u2019s not always so great for the companies whose employees are signing up to use whatever they want to.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p id=\"ca50\">Employees tend to want to use the latest tech, coolest tools, and most up-to-date versions of a framework, however, that means the possibility of breaking something that is stable to introduce a new variable that can cause bugs or require refactoring.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p id=\"6bfd\">When everyone is storing their data and working in their own platforms, things get messy. It becomes much slower to move projects forward, and IT can\u2019t get a handle on everything used in order to integrate or downsize solutions.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<blockquote class=\"wp-block-quote\">\n<p>\u201cIn large organizations, the number one productivity killer is the amount of interdependencies accumulated over time. Once you pass a critical threshold, there will always be some other integrated system working on their own that will stall the process. Eventually, everybody will be waiting on everybody else. The only solution is organizational, cutting the IT landscape into independent domains owned by business divisions, not IT.\u201d \u2014 Sten Vesterli,&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/www.vesterli.com\/\">Technology Advisor<\/a><\/p>\n<\/blockquote>\n\n\n\n<div style=\"height:100px\" aria-hidden=\"true\" class=\"wp-block-spacer\"><\/div>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\" id=\"3516\">Problem 4. Meetings that are unnecessary, poorly timed, or unorganized<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p id=\"b680\">We all know that meetings can be a huge time suck. The problem is that you often don\u2019t know a meeting will be a waste of time until it\u2019s already too late.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p id=\"4600\">Meetings can waste time in numerous ways: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ul>\n<li>Wrong people in attendance, or too many unnecessary people in attendance<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Wrong timing for the meeting (can get pushed out farther to when the project is officially approved, for example)<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>The meeting is unorganized and goes off-topic<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<blockquote class=\"wp-block-quote\">\n<p>\u201cI\u2019ve been in too many meetings that didn\u2019t apply to me at all. Meeting organizers often blanket invite people from a team or organization. Instead, they should take the time to select the relevant team members for the meeting.\u201d \u2014&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/tynick.com\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">Tyson Nichols, AWS\/Linux Platform Engineer<\/a><\/p>\n<\/blockquote>\n\n\n\n<p id=\"cefe\">To resolve the poorly organized meeting issue, consider whether a meeting is needed at all. Maybe the project could have taken place via&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/open.buffer.com\/asynchronous-communication\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">async communication and collaboration<\/a>&nbsp;in an organized chat thread or Google doc instead of a meeting.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-large\"><img decoding=\"async\" loading=\"lazy\" width=\"1024\" height=\"552\" src=\"https:\/\/images.golinks.io\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/12\/13094934\/async-1024x552.png\" alt=\"Productivity Problem #5: unorganized meetings \" class=\"wp-image-3631\" srcset=\"https:\/\/images.golinks.io\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/12\/13094934\/async-1024x552.png 1024w, https:\/\/images.golinks.io\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/12\/13094934\/async-300x162.png 300w, https:\/\/images.golinks.io\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/12\/13094934\/async-768x414.png 768w, https:\/\/images.golinks.io\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/12\/13094934\/async-40x22.png 40w, https:\/\/images.golinks.io\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/12\/13094934\/async-670x361.png 670w, https:\/\/images.golinks.io\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/12\/13094934\/async.png 1340w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 1024px) 100vw, 1024px\" \/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p id=\"15ee\">You can also resolve meeting issues by training anyone who runs meetings on how to do it effectively. Every quarter, hold a training session on how to run meetings and make it required that everyone attend one session per year. The time your company spends in that one training session will impact the productivity of all meetings the entire year.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p id=\"f520\">When people go to meetings, they often arrive with a passive attitude. It\u2019s up to the meeting organizer to invite the right people and make sure they accomplish the agenda.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<div style=\"height:100px\" aria-hidden=\"true\" class=\"wp-block-spacer\"><\/div>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\" id=\"5b38\">Problem 6. Speed of innovation causing technical debt<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p id=\"5293\">Tech companies enjoy moving fast and breaking things. It\u2019s critical to be mindful of the technical debt you\u2019re likely building up while you innovate. Especially for early-stage companies, technical debt can build up rapidly. <\/p>\n\n\n\n<p id=\"8eb3\">Make sure to set aside some bandwidth each quarter to resolve some of the tech debt that you\u2019re probably racking up.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p id=\"fe97\">Doing a little bit extra work to clean up and organize your projects can save you hundreds of hours in the long run. One SaaS co-founder knows this issue all too well\u2026<\/p>\n\n\n\n<blockquote class=\"wp-block-quote\">\n<p>\u201cThe thing that has cost us more time than anything in our SaaS company is technical debt. When our product was in the early days, we were distracted by a large client project. We didn\u2019t effectively manage our developers during that time. Three years later, we are still spending countless hours repairing code that was built back then and it often delays feature releases, sometimes up to 6 months. \u201d \u2014 James Rose, Co-founder of&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/contentsnare.com\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">Content Snare<\/a><\/p>\n<\/blockquote>\n\n\n\n<div style=\"height:100px\" aria-hidden=\"true\" class=\"wp-block-spacer\"><\/div>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\" id=\"24e8\">Problem 7. Constant chat app distractions<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-large\"><img decoding=\"async\" loading=\"lazy\" width=\"1024\" height=\"523\" src=\"https:\/\/images.golinks.io\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/12\/13102209\/chat-1-1024x523.png\" alt=\"Productivity problem #8: constant chat distractions\" class=\"wp-image-3635\" srcset=\"https:\/\/images.golinks.io\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/12\/13102209\/chat-1-1024x523.png 1024w, https:\/\/images.golinks.io\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/12\/13102209\/chat-1-300x153.png 300w, https:\/\/images.golinks.io\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/12\/13102209\/chat-1-768x392.png 768w, https:\/\/images.golinks.io\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/12\/13102209\/chat-1-40x20.png 40w, https:\/\/images.golinks.io\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/12\/13102209\/chat-1.png 1340w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 1024px) 100vw, 1024px\" \/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p id=\"37ef\">Yes, chat apps are better than long emails, but they come with their own host of problems. They are distracting, and because people often expect an immediate response, they force you to choose between the meaningful work you were previously engaged in and helping a team member.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<blockquote class=\"wp-block-quote\">\n<p>\u201cThe most common interruptions turn out to be those which should drive your productivity: email and chat applications. Both are demanding attention right when you should be focused and productive. This isn\u2019t helped by team members who built up a technology-fueled expectation of constant availability thanks to Slack and similar tools.\u201d\u2014 Peter Thaleikis,&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/bringyourownideas.com\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">Software Developer<\/a><\/p>\n<\/blockquote>\n\n\n\n<p id=\"114c\">To fix this problem, you need to make it clear that people at your company are not and should not be expected to be constantly available.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p id=\"9f51\">Make sure that team members know how to use features to show that they are in focus mode. For example, in Slack you can set a status to \u201cwriting\u201d or \u201ccoding,\u201d and you can also use \u201cdo not disturb\u201d mode. In&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/tandem.chat\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">Tandem<\/a>, you can enter \u201cfocus\u201d mode.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-large\"><img decoding=\"async\" loading=\"lazy\" width=\"1024\" height=\"523\" src=\"https:\/\/images.golinks.io\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/12\/13103019\/focus-1024x523.png\" alt=\"Change your status in Slack to enter &quot;focus&quot; mode \" class=\"wp-image-3640\" srcset=\"https:\/\/images.golinks.io\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/12\/13103019\/focus-1024x523.png 1024w, https:\/\/images.golinks.io\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/12\/13103019\/focus-300x153.png 300w, https:\/\/images.golinks.io\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/12\/13103019\/focus-768x392.png 768w, https:\/\/images.golinks.io\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/12\/13103019\/focus-40x20.png 40w, https:\/\/images.golinks.io\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/12\/13103019\/focus.png 1340w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 1024px) 100vw, 1024px\" \/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p id=\"4c70\">If you don\u2019t set this precedent, productivity will suffer.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<blockquote class=\"wp-block-quote\">\n<p>\u201cWe often feel like we need to answer or check a notification from Slack as soon as we get it. It\u2019s ok to leave it there while you finish your task at hand. If someone needs to get a hold of you right this moment, they will find a way. Setting a status of something like \u201cCoding\u201d is a nice way of letting them know you are trying to focus.\u201d \u2014&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/tynick.com\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">Tyson Nichols, AWS\/Linux Platform Engineer<\/a><\/p>\n<\/blockquote>\n\n\n\n<p id=\"ba0e\">The worst thing that can happen is for everyone at your company to think that quickly responding to every single chat message is something to be proud of.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<blockquote class=\"wp-block-quote\">\n<p>\u201cMeaningful work can be interrupted with the impression of feeling busy. In large companies, the impact of the volume of chat messages and notifications on concentration is obvious. There\u2019s no way to distinguish which instructions are urgent and what isn\u2019t.\u201d \u2014 Alice Bedward, Digital Marketing Specialist at&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/roosh.online\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">Roosh<\/a><\/p>\n<\/blockquote>\n\n\n\n<div style=\"height:100px\" aria-hidden=\"true\" class=\"wp-block-spacer\"><\/div>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\" id=\"5a3d\">Problem 9. Context switching<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p id=\"953b\">While chat messages force us into continual context-switching, there are other parts of our day that have us struggling to adapt. Context switching simply means switching from one type of work to another.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p id=\"8d9d\">Very few people remain productive when faced with repetitive, constant context switching.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<blockquote class=\"wp-block-quote\">\n<p>\u201cAt my SaaS startup, my biggest challenge is context switching. It\u2019s a huge challenge to get my head in the right space in order to complete each task to the best of my ability. My secret is to focus 100% on one task at a time. I do not start the next task until I tick off the previous task as complete. That way I can mentally reset.\u201d \u2014 Matthew Johnson, General Manager of&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/www.userback.io\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">Userback.io<\/a><\/p>\n<\/blockquote>\n\n\n\n<p id=\"b6e7\">To combat this issue, encourage your team to organize their day in a way that batches similar tasks and projects. Other strategies include blocking out time in your calendar to focus on specific tasks, utilizing the&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/blog.trello.com\/how-to-pomodoro-your-way-to-productivity\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">Pomodoro technique<\/a>, and better evaluating the time required to complete a specific task.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<div style=\"height:59px\" aria-hidden=\"true\" class=\"wp-block-spacer\"><\/div>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">FAQs<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>How do you measure productivity loss within a tech company?<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>Measuring productivity loss within a tech company involves analyzing various metrics such as employee output, project completion rates, time spent on tasks, and overall revenue generated per unit of time.
